My first impression on the ride quality of this car is far better than spark. I decided on buying this and got it delivered on 2nd of January 09.


Have completed 1150kms on the odo.


I am back with few interesting information on Astar.


Pros:


1) Performace is very good and does not feel sluggish


2) Frot seats are comfortable and steering feel is good.


3) Small turning radius and good road grip on speeds above 80kmph(Did not test top speed yet)


4) Mileage seems to be good (Around 17 -18) roughly based on the digital fuel gauge reading. (Have not tested it tank full to tank full method).


5) Looks, Sure a head turner.


6) Ground Clearance is really big for indian roads.


7) Gear shift is very sporty (Exactly like swift).


Cons:


1) Rear seat comfort : Not at all comfortable for taller people.


2) Small vibration is present when the engine is in Idle speed (Has consulted the Maruthi dealer , says its common in 3 cylinder engine)


3) Engine is a bit noisy in First Gear (Only in First Gear , remaining gears are smooth)


3) Boot Space is really low. (Less luggage space)


4) Rear window screen has a partition which obstructs the vision of the occupants.


Hope these information will be helpful for readers who are willing to buy A-Star.


Updated on 06/Dec/2009Iam getting an mileage of 17.85/ litre Mileage on Average.... with 30% City Driving.


Apart form that I dont see any change in performance and driving comfort its as new as when I bought one year back.


Updated on 15/Jun/2010Best Mileage achieved 28.31


YesterdayI drovethe car in NH7 over 300Kms , I was trying my luck to get the maximum out of my A-star in mileage front. I filled up the tank till the brim and reset my trip meter and drove till 283.1 and tried filling my car again to tank full (again to brim level) It consumed exactly 9.98 Litres of petrol . Just thought of sharing it among A-star owners.


Think it was great seeing close to 30Kmpl mileage.


Driving Conditons :


Used NH47 throughout the journey.


Less traffic, so less braking and gear changes.


Speed not exceeding 60kmph(Took 5.5hrs total to travel this distance)


total of only 4 speed humps on the way.


Waiting time in 4 toll gates on the way ( 5 mins max - idling)


No speeding while overtaking slow moving vehicles also.


Note: For the past 6 months I am using the vehicle inside the city only with congested traffic, itmanaged to give only 15Kmpl on every refill.
